Electrocution Hazard!

Always turn the Eurorack case off and unplug the power cord before plugging or un-plugging any Eurorack 

bus board connection cable cable. 

Do not touch any electrical terminals when attaching any Eurorack bus board cable. 

The Make Noise Rene is an electronic music module requiring 80 mA of +12VDC and 0 mA of -12VDC 

regulated voltage and a properly formatted distribution receptacle to operate. It must be properly installed 

into a Eurorack format modular synthesizer system case.

To install, find 34HP of space in your Eurorack synthesizer case, confirm proper installation of included 

eurorack bus board connector cable on backside of module (see picture below), plug the bus board 

connector cable into the Eurorack style bus board, minding the polarity so that the RED stripe on the cable is 

oriented to the NEGATIVE 12 Volt line on both the module and the bus board. On the Make Noise 6U or 3U 

Busboard, the negative 12 Volt line is indicated by the white stripe. 

The René module is not compatible with power solutions using the MeanWell brand AC Adapters.  

The René module will not work on power solution using the MeanWell brand AC Adapters.  

Make Noise will not be able to provide support for René modules used on power solutions using the 

MeanWell brand AC Adapters.

Please refer to your case manufacturers’ specifications for location of the negative 

supply.
